By Will Dickins
North Delta is headed to the playoffs.  With an ending only found in fiction books and Hollywood, the Green Wave get to accomplish their goals set at the beginning of the season.
On a night of emotion, with seniors being honored for all of their hard work and dedication, North Delta took the field knowing a win would secure a spot in the playoffs.  On a last second throw and prayer to the end zone from Will Kidder to Harris Cole, that spot was secured. Prayers were answered.
Brandon Ciaramitaro knew the weight of this game, and his team answered.
“Wow! What a great memory our team made Friday night! It was a senior night to remember.  Moments like that will last a lifetime in the minds of our football team.  I could not be more proud of our boys and their relentlessness.  I think they realized how much weight the game had on our season because you could see it in their play.  The win secures us a spot in the playoffs. Our team had a goal at the beginning of the season to make it past the first round of the playoffs.  The goal is achievable now.”
That is a great way to end the season, right? Nevertheless, North Delta heads to Somerville, Tenn. to play Fayette Academy Friday night for the last game of the season.
They look to end the season on a good note before heading into the playoffs.
“Fayette Academy will be a test Friday with multiple threats out of the double wing-flex bone formation and a blitz happy defense.  Come support the team in Somerville, Tenn.”
Kickoff is 7 p.m. tonight. The school is an hour and a half away.
